Mediterranean Diet Linked to Enhanced Brain Health in Hispanic Adults, Study Shows
A new study reveals significant brain health benefits for Hispanic/Latino adults following a Mediterranean diet, with improvements in brain connectivity and structure independent of cardiovascular factors, highlighting important implications for the fastest-growing ethnic group in the U.S.

A Mediterranean-style diet has been linked to improved brain health and enhanced neural connectivity in Hispanic/Latino adults, according to preliminary research to be presented at the American Stroke Association's International Stroke Conference 2025. The findings suggest that even modest adherence to this dietary pattern can lead to measurable improvements in brain structure and function.
The groundbreaking study, which focused on approximately 2,800 Hispanic/Latino adults aged 18-74, found that higher adherence to a Mediterranean diet was associated with better white matter integrity and reduced evidence of small vessel brain disease. These benefits persisted even after accounting for cardiovascular risk factors such as blood pressure and cholesterol levels.
"Even small improvements in diet improved brain integrity," noted lead researcher Dr. Gabriela Trifan from the University of Illinois in Chicago. The study is particularly significant as it represents the first large-scale investigation focusing solely on Hispanic/Latino adults, who are projected to become the fastest-growing ethnic group in the United States.
The research holds particular promise for healthcare providers serving Hispanic/Latino communities, as many traditional Latin foods already align with Mediterranean diet principles, including beans, corn, tomatoes, peppers, avocado, and fish. This natural dietary overlap suggests that beneficial modifications could be implemented without dramatic changes to established eating patterns.
